AceShowbiz - OG Maco reportedly has been hospitalized following an apparent suicide attempt. On Thursday morning, December 12, the Atlanta rapper was found unresponsive in his home and was taken to the hospital after a neighbor called 911 to report a gunshot around 10 A.M.

According to TMZ , OG Maco suffered a seemingly self-inflicted gunshot wound to the head and entered surgery. Los Angeles police claimed that a firearm was recovered from the crime scene.

Speaking to the news outlet, OG Maco's manager Poppa Percccc shared that the trap rap pioneer is still alive. While he didn't offer more details about the musician's condition, he asked fans to send their prayers for the "U Guessed It" rapper.

Prior to this, OG Maco opened up about struggling with depression. He additionally revealed in a 2019 interview with Complex that he had been suffering from necrotising fasciitis, a flesh eating disease.

"I was scared, I didn't know what was going to happen," he admitted at the time. "I didn't know if I was going to lose my entire face… Almost did."

OG Maco added that he had suicidal thoughts on more than one occasion. "I wanted to die a bunch of days," the rapper recalled. "Everybody I really thought would be here, who I really thought I could depend on, weren't there."

The musician has indeed been through a lot. In 2016, he was involved in a near fatal incident which left him with a vision impairment. "Thank God I ain't too cool for the safe belt," OG Maco wrote on Twitter, now X, following the crash.

As for his music career, OG Maco faced his own obstacle. In 2022, he claimed that he had been "blackballed" by Quality Control Music. He accused the label of refusing to promote his work with other fellow Quality Control artists, such as Migos, City Girls and Lil Yachty.
